http://adionline.myrice.com/JSP/ConnectionPool-Servlet.htm去看看,原理加代码。一般web服务器都自带有连接池,看看它的相关文档。

解决方案 »

  1.   

    连接池浅显的说就是保持许多连接的集合,这个集合在你的整个程序运行期都保持着,而你调用是这个集合中的某个实例。看了你的需求,如果不是刷新间隔太长(超过数据库的延迟时间),或者太短(也就是刷新太频繁),你保持一个连接就可以,一直到程序结束再释放(当然,这有一个前提:你的jsp只有一个实例在运行,事实上应用中不可能)。你也可以自己建立连接池,但最好使用Web Server提供的连接池。
      

  2.   

    如果Tomcat,他自带数据库连接池的,还有想weblogic都有
      

  3.   

    http://adionline.myrice.com/JSP/ConnectionPool-Servlet.htm